Timeline:

This timeline shows a graph from 1991 to 2015 of Australia. No data until 1990. Number of actual observations by date: 25.

Source name:

World Development Indicators

Source organization:

International Labour Organization, using World Bank population estimates.

Categories, topics:

Education, Social Protection & Labor

Last updated:

apr 23, 2017
